Here are a few nighttime pics from the supercell that eventually spawned 2 tornados and tennis ball size hail. Tornadoes are confirmed near Fort Gibson and south of Sallisaw. These shot are from Wagoner county just as the cell was crossing into Muskogee county and minutes before it went tornado warned around 9pm.

Chased in SW Oklahoma after a detour in north Texas , we finally got on the Lawton cell in Walters with a beautiful view of the LP . We followed the cell SE to the red river and gave up due to night fall. Fun to dust off and get ready for May.
